Hard Choices is a memoir by Hillary Rodham Clinton, detailing her four-year tenure as the 67th U.S. Secretary of State. The book offers an insider's perspective on pivotal global events, including the Arab Spring, the U.S. "pivot to Asia," the killing of Osama bin Laden, and the 2012 Benghazi attack. Clinton discusses her diplomatic engagements across 112 countries, emphasizing the use of "smart power"—a blend of diplomacy, development, and defense—to navigate complex international challenges. She also reflects on personal experiences, such as reconciling with President Obama after the 2008 primaries and her evolving views on the Iraq War. The memoir provides a nuanced look at the complexities of foreign policy and the personal convictions that influenced her decisions.
